Our Vision is to eliminate homelessness in the ur ban communities of San Diego Country through a cooperative partnership wi th faith-based communities\, related government programs and social servi ce agencies. The Interfaith Shelter Network does not discriminate based o n race\, color\, religion\, gender\, sexual orientation\, national origin \, age or disabilities in hiring practice or provision of services. The “ crown jewel” of the Interfaith Shelter Network of San Diego is the Rotati onal Shelter Program. This is a seasonal emergency shelter program that t akes in men\, women and families with children. The Network involves over 120 congregations of all denominations county-wide in a Rotational Shelt er program. About 70 of the congregations host the program in their facil ities for two or four weeks a year and the remainder serve in a valuable support role\, providing volunteers for meals and overnight hosting\, tra nsportation and donations. Through neighborhood congregations linking wit h others\, people are sheltered where there are no shelters and receive t he understanding and support of congregations when previously all they kn ew was fear and uncertainty. Congregations benefit by getting to know hom eless individuals personally and the mutual sharing of stories is benefic ial to both.
